AECOM is hiring a Senior Project Coordinator - Building Engineering

About the Role

About the Role

Role details below.

Responsibilities

  • Coordinate project schedules, Salesforce setup, and document workflows to ensure timely project execution.
  • Prepare and maintain project documentation, ensuring compliance with AECOM standards and governance.
  • Support project delivery through meeting setups, project planning, and financial coordination.
  • Assist with team management tasks, including briefings, travel arrangements, and security clearances.
  • Foster collaboration across teams to meet stakeholder needs and maintain high-quality governance standards.

Requirements

  • Proven project administration experience, ideally 5+ years in construction, infrastructure, professional services, or Defence.
  • Ability to manage multiple priorities and meet tight deadlines.
  • Strong organisational and multitasking skills.
  • High attention to detail and the ability to maintain accurate records and track milestones.
  • Excellent communication and stakeholder management skills.
  • Ability to build relationships and prepare professional reports, correspondence, and presentations.
  • Proficiency in Microsoft Office Suite (Word, Excel, PowerPoint, Outlook).
  • Proficiency in project management tools (MS Project).
  • Professionalism and adaptability: proactive, solutions-focused, and collaborative.
  • Ability to thrive in fast-paced, multidisciplinary teams.

About company
AECOM
AECOM is the world's trusted infrastructure consulting firm, delivering solutions in water, environment, energy, transportation, and buildings. The company partners with public- and private-sector clients to solve complex challenges and build legacies through advisory, planning, design, engineering, and construction management. A Fortune 500 firm with $16.1 billion revenue in fiscal year 2025.
